The present invention consists in the presentation of a new industrial facility for sustainable development ([1]) combining and optimizing the best treatment techniques, water (reverse osmosis and seawater distillation) and waste (biogas) for combat the depletion of the world's water and energy resources. This same invention aims to solve the problems related to high energy consumption, salt discharges at the seaside and to supply water, heating and electricity to any living population in areas or non-isolated. It was chosen, on the one hand, to combine an optimized reverse osmosis plant with a distillery of seawater to desalinate seawater and on the other hand, to graft a biogas plant there , forming the third branch needed to obtain this new industrial facility, self-powered electricity, providing a comprehensive and comprehensive solution in terms of water production opportunities without releases of salt, electricity and heat, all , promoting the elimination of domestic waste. This unique facility will address the inevitable worldwide water shortage in the coming years and the growing energy needs of the population while promoting environmentally friendly disposal of sludge.
